OC-3 |
An optical fiber that transmits data between two network devices. An OC-3 line runs at three times the base rate (3 x 51.84 Mbps). |

ODBC Support |
Object Database Connectivity (ODBC) support allows ODBC compliant applications to connect to an ODBC database and extract data without requiring that the user have programming skills. For example,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Access, and mySQL are ODBC compliant applications. Using ODBC and mySQL a user can import data directly into an Excel spreadsheet once mySQL ODBC drivers have been installed on the user"s computer. |

Off-Line Transaction Processing |
Capture of order and credit card information for later authorization and transaction processing through a traditional card swipe terminal or through a computer. |

Open Database Connectivity (ODBC) |
A standard for accessing different database systems. There are interfaces for Visual Basic, Visual C++, SQL and the ODBC driver pack contains drivers for the Access, Paradox, dBase, Text, Excel and Btrieve databases. |

Order Management System |
A system that accepts orders and initiates a process that results in the outbound shipment of a finished good. |
